What is Cym. ‘Princess Masako’

Cymbidium 'Princess Masako' ,scientific name: Cymbidium Seaside ' Princess Masako', is an evergreen perennial orchid garden variety of Cymbidium genus of the Orchidaceae department. There are varieties was presented in the origin of Crown Princess Masako and the Crown Prince married. It is a dark pink-tinged a pale pink Cymbidium.

Common name: Cym. seaside "Princess Masako', scientific name: Cymbidium Seaside 'Princess Masako', origin: horticultural varieties, height: 80-90 cm, pseudobulbs, Leaf shape: linear-oblong, left-right asymmetric flower, flower diameter: 5-10 cm, flowering: December-March, flower color: gray pink
